First and foremost, buying a carisn’t a cheap investment. When you trade your hard earned cash for a vehicle, you will not get it back. Set your target budget and think about what sort of car would suit your needs. This might be a good first step, as Automobiles are usually classified per category when seeking on-line.
Another initial consideration is whether or not you’re going to get a brand new or used car. This obviously is based on the set budget, and would cut short the list of web sites you’d be looking at. Remember, there are a whole lot of options on the market.The idea is to find the best offer without drowning yourself.
Now that you’ve got these in mind, you are ready to look for your car of preference on-line. Remember, investing in a car is similar to getting a personal computer; you want to be sure you are getting the real thing which means that your preference in buying would be those with reputable brands who have been in the industry for the longest time and are recognized to have good clean records. Search around the net for those websites which are the preference of many automobile buyers and enthusiast alike. If selling on-line is easy, then destroying the name of dishonest or unlikable sellers is as simple as well!
Yet another thing to consider is the selling of stolen cars, or those which were retrieved from calamities like huge floods and hurricanes. Obviously, you wouldn’t want to own these cars no matter how well they covered up or restored. If you are planning to acquire a car online, obtain the details and check it with your nearest Government Automobile Agency to check its VIN history report to evaluate its worth.
Purchasing a car is really a huge step toward marking your personal investments. The money is one thing which you have worked hard for and you need to make sure you are getting your money’s worth. Remember, online purchasing may be easy; but don’t commit right away! Close the deal only after you have seen the particular unit and have taken it for a test drive.
